This is a simple tool to convert an SPDX to a OCI Artifact and push the SPDX doc to an OCI registry with annotations.
Run make to build the binary or use the following command to build the binary.
go build -ldflags "-s -w" -o obom main.gogo get github.com/Azure/obom obom [command]
- obom show - Show SPDX Document
- obom push - Push SPDX Document to OCI Registry
- obom packages - List Packages
- obom files - List Files
Sub command that shows the SPDX Document summary.
$ obom show -f ./examples/SPDXJSONExample-v2.3.spdx.json

================================================================================Sub command that pushes the SPDX Document to an OCI registry and adds annotations to the OCI Artifact. Annotations are the SPDX Document properties and can be overriden by the command line flags.
$ obom push -f ./examples/SPDXJSONExample-v2.3.spdx.json localhost:5001/spdx:example
